Obverse (heads):
This design features an eagle in flight grasping an olive branch, symbolizing peace, in its right talon.
The design is inspired by the 1945 version of the Great Seal of the United States, where the eagle faces to the right, toward the olive branch. Inscriptions are “LIBERTY,” “1945,” and “WORLD WAR II.”

Reverse (tails):
This design echoes the sun element on the obverse of the 1945 World War II Victory Medal.
The sun from that medal has, 75 years later, risen to noon day brilliance. It shines on the olive branches. The inscription is “75th ANNIVERSARY.”

Artistic Infusion Program (AIP) artist Ronald Sanders created the obverse design. Mint Medallic Artist Phebe Hemphill sculpted it. The reverse design was created by AIP artist Donna Weaver and sculpted by Mint Medallic Artist Renata Gordon.
The U.S. Mint joins other mints around the world, such as the Royal Mint (United Kingdom) and the Monnaie de Paris (France), in marking this anniversary.
